Abstract

This invention relates to a nucleic acid that contains at least one nucleic acid sequence coding for a polypeptide, polypeptide being capable of reducing the enzymatic activity of an invertase; the polypeptide itself; and transgenic plants that contain this nucleic acid sequence. The invention further relates to methods of preparing such transgenic plants having reduced storage sucrose loss.
